What companies run services between Leicester, England and Ammanford, Wales?

You can take a train from Leicester to Ammanford via Birmingham New Street, Bristol Parkway, and Swansea in around 6h 21m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from St Margaret's Bus Station to Ammanford Bus Station Stand 4 via Birmingham Coach Station and Cross Hands Library in around 8h 21m.
